Transaction 059bfac7105b50f4b2df53a223d91342534016d7efe3e8a190f6af164c7dbd5e

1 Input
2 Outputs
  • 059bfac7105b50f4b2df53a223d91342534016d7efe3e8a190f6af164c7dbd5e:0
  • value  88910569
    address  1Cb4gS8za8ZwEKBSHS7KqW1143i9jpMD3z
  • 059bfac7105b50f4b2df53a223d91342534016d7efe3e8a190f6af164c7dbd5e:1
  • value  1460000
    address  1MMQWNEK2YuqmUboh1JeDheFug8bRMcuRG